Erosional origin of numerous valleys remaining in the recent and ancient relief has been proved. Shapes, cross-sections and distribution of river valleys were investigated. Seismic acoustic data were interpreted and map of ancient river valleys existed on the Barents and Kara Seas Shelf during Late Cenozoic regressions has been compiled. Maximum of neotectonic uplift and major regression was shown to occur during Late Miocene.</p></abstract><trans-abstract xml:lang="en"><p>Evolution of ancient rivers on the Barents and Kara Seas Shelf through the Late Cenozoic is considered.
